Hypoxia
noun
A condition in which there is insufficient oxygen available to the body's tissues.
At high altitudes, people may experience symptoms of hypoxia.

noun
A decrease in the oxygen supply to a specific region in the body, often leading to damage or dysfunction.
In cases of carbon monoxide poisoning, hypoxia can quickly set in.

noun
The condition where oxygen levels in the atmosphere are reduced, affecting breathing.
Hypoxia can occur in enclosed spaces where ventilation is poor.

Medical Context
Understanding hypoxia is vital in emergency medicine, as it can lead to serious health complications.
In treated environments, like hospitals, managing hypoxia properly is crucial.
Athletic Performance
Athletes often train at high altitudes to stimulate their body’s adaptation to hypoxia.
Training in hypoxic conditions can enhance endurance.
Environmental Effects
Areas with high pollution levels can result in local hypoxia.
Urban planning must consider air quality to prevent hypoxia in vulnerable populations.
